Delegation welcomes Elite Airways to local airport

Historic City News learned this week that, with thanks in no small part to Mayo Clinic, beginning July 20, 2018, Elite Airways will begin operating flights between Rochester, Minnesota and the Northeast Florida Regional Airport in St. Augustine.

O’Connell family believes Michelle didn’t commit suicide

When St. Johns County sheriff’s deputies arrived at the St. Augustine, Florida, home of Jeremy Banks on Sept. 2, 2010, they found his 24-year-old girlfriend Michelle O’Connell lying on the floor with a gunshot wound to the head and dozens of prescription painkillers in her pocket.
